Double Glazed Window Repairs Near Me

If you're seeking double glazing window repairs in the vicinity of your home, there are plenty of things that can cause your window to leak. It is necessary to have your insulation glazing unit (IGU), replaced or sealed. Also, you should think about ways to cut down on heat loss through the window. You might also have to reglaze bay windows.

Replace a broken glass pane

Whether you have a single pane or double pane windows, replacing the glass is a great idea. It will not just save you money but can also help maintain your temperature and increase energy efficiency.

However, the cost of replacing your windows can vary in a wide range depending on the style and size of your windows. It's possible for the price to be as high as $500 or as low as $150. Before you hire a contractor, it's important to be aware of the terms of service you're entering into.

You'll want the finest quality glass if you are replacing the glass in a windowsill. The best method for doing this is to find an organization that is specialized in window glass. It is recommended to get several quotes to ensure you get the best price.


The cost of replacing a single pane of glass is about $50. It can be much more expensive if you are required to replace the entire window unit.

You can always fix the glass yourself if do not want to spend the money replacing the windows. You can even try it yourself. If you have some construction experience, you can install your own glass, using caulking that is light and glazing points.

You can employ a glazier if you don't have time or the ability to tackle the task on your own. They'll assess your window for a minimal cost. They also provide free estimates. It is recommended to request three quotes to ensure you have a variety of options.

Replace the IGU, which is an insulated-glass unit (IGU).

Your home warm in the winter and cooler in the summer is easy using insulated glass. It reduces the loss of heat and helps keep your air conditioning costs lower. In addition, it can improve the value of your home. There are many options available to meet your needs whether you require new windows or are looking to repair the ones you have.

Insulated glass is designed to keep condensation from forming inside your home. It has multiple panes separated by spacers. The spacers can be made from structural foam or made of metal. These are custom-designed and available in a wide range of sizes and shapes.

The lifespan of an insulated glass unit (IGU) will vary, based on the conditions in which it is placed and the quality of the materials used. IGUs generally last between 10 to 20 years. It is also affected by the distance between the inner and outer panes. The failure of an IGU can be caused by temperature fluctuations, sunlight, and the type or glazing sealant employed.

If your insulated window is damaged, you'll have to replace it. It is not advised to attempt a DIY project, as it is difficult to determine what caused the damage. A professional can also guarantee the most effective results.

It is not always necessary to replace the entire window when windows with double panes break. It is possible to save money by replacing the pane. This is a faster and cheaper solution as opposed to having to replace the whole window.

Glaze on a bay window

You have many options when reglazing bay windows. The cost of repair will depend on the type of glass used and the size of the window, and the number of panes that are damaged.

The most popular type of residential glass is double pane insulated glass units. These windows are rated for energy efficiency and have more soundproofing than single pane windows. The seals of these units are not always sealed properly and can break which causes fog and moisture to accumulate.

Replacement windows can be very expensive. Most people spend around $12 to $13 dollars for a square foot for a typical residential window. If you're looking to cut costs on your energy bill You can put in solar film or storm windows.

Double pane windows will usually cost $200 to $600 to replace. While this is a substantial investment, it will provide you greater energy efficiency as well as soundproofing.

Maintaining your windows' seals is vital. Failure to seal your windows could result in condensation fogging, a decrease in energy efficiency. If you've got a damaged window seal, there are several ways to repair it. For assistance, speak to an expert window installer in case you're not sure how to fix it yourself.

The first step is to examine the area surrounding the window. If you find cracks in the caulking around the window frame You can use a putty tool to cut out the caulking that is broken. Then, wash the window with a damp cloth. This will get rid of dirt or grime and other debris.

A cleaning agent is another option. The proper cleaning agent will be determined by the type of seal material. It will also eliminate any moisture and dust.

You could also replace the glass unit that is insulated to fix problems with window seals. Manufacturers will often provide new IGUs. This is a cost-effective alternative than replacing the entire window.

No matter if you decide to have your IGU replaced, the most important thing you should remember is that a damaged window seal could make your home uncomfortable. You'll notice a reduction in energy efficiency as well as an increase in the cost of power.

The most obvious indication of a damaged window seal is the fogging. The cause of fogging is humidity trapped between glass panes. It's not uncommon for the fog to get worse due to changes in the weather outside.

Routine inspections are the most effective way to find out if your window seals have failed. This will let you determine whether the window seals need to be replaced.

If you are in the market for replacement windows, consider buying windows that come with a warranty. Many manufacturers offer a quality warranty that ranges from 3 to 15 years.

Reduce heat loss through the window space

Keeping heat loss from windows under control is essential for the energy efficiency of your home. This can be achieved in a variety of ways. There are three factors that affect the transfer of heat through your windows. The frame material, the U-factor and the glazing component. Each of these factors contributes differently to the overall energy consumption of your home.

The U-factor is a measurement of the degree to which a window absorbs and reflects sunlight's heat. You can decrease the U-factor of your windows, which will determine how efficiently your home cools and heats.

The U-factor of your windows can be reduced using low-conductivity materials and specially designed gases. These include argon, Krypton, and other low conductivity materials. These gases have a lower thermal conductivity than air. This means that they can be used to replace air and increase your windows' thermal efficiency.

The glass component of your window may also be modified to assist with the heat transfer. This can be done by applying a coating of low-emittance on the glass's surface. The U-value of the entire unit will be lower if the glass's outside surface is uniform from top to bottom. To decrease heat transfer through the glazing you can utilize multiple layers of glass.

Another way to limit the loss of heat is by having blinds or curtains installed. Shades are used to keep heat in your home and block heat from the windows during daylight hours. They are especially helpful during winter when temperatures are low. They can also be used to avoid condensation from forming on windows.
